LINUX.ORG.RU

История изменений

Исправление sena, (текущая версия) :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- обеспечить д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ть, чтобы можно было как раньше, наб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ить интерпретатор всего этого в небольшой легкий бинарник, да ещё и сохранить совместимость.

Возможности шелла прекрасно расширяются путём написания новых команд. Хоть на лиспе, хоть на чём.

Да, из шела можно запустить фаерфокс. Но я немного о другом, о расширении самого языка.

Исправление s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- обеспечить д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ть, чтобы можно было как раньше, наб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ить интерпретатор всего этого в небольшой легкий бинарник, да ещё и сохранить совместимость.

Исправление s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- обеспечить д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ть чтобы можно было как раньше наб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ить интерпретатор всего этого в небольшой легкий бинарник, да ещё и сохранить совместимость.

Исправление s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- обеспечить д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ть чтобы можно было как раньше наб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ить интерпретатор всего этого в небольшой легкий бинарник, да ещё сохранить совместимость.

Исправление s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- обеспечить д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ть чтобы можно было как раньше наб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ить всё это в небольшой легкий бинарник, да ещё сохранить совместимость.

Исправление s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ть чтобы можно было как раньше наб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ить всё это в небольшой легкий бинарник, да ещё сохранить совместимость.

Исходная версия sena, :

Но зачем?

Надо почитать ветку дискуссии, из которой это произошло. @ugoday вполне корректно обосновал пожелания в этом посте.

Задача - дальнейшее развитие шела, но при этом надо оставить обратную совместимость, его простоту в решении простых задач и при этом дать возможность при необходимости избавиться от болезней шела типа проблем с пробелами, экранировками и т.п.

То есть чтобы можно было как раньше набросать по-быстрому грязный скрипт, который решит текущую проблемку и чтобы можно было тут же сделать красиво, безопасно, читаемо, расширяемо и при этом уместить всё это в небольшой легкий бинарник.